Union minister Rao Inderjit Singh and senior Haryana leader Anil Vij have built a reputation for not missing any opportunity to target their own government, keeping chief minister Nayab Singh Saini's government perpetually on edge.

On September 12, seven-time MLA and state minister Anil Vij alleged on X that in his Ambala Cantt constituency "some people are running a parallel BJP with the blessings of those above".

Vij further raised eyebrows on Thursday by quietly dropping "minister" from his X bio, changing it from "Anil Vij, minister, Haryana" to simply "Anil Vij, Haryana." As speculation mounted, he clarified: "I want my followership to be completely organic."


If Vij makes noise through his posts, Union minister Rao Inderjit Singh keeps the government guessing through his statements - and dinner diplomacy. In his latest jab, Singh expressed disappointment over delays in the Gurugram Metro Project, demanding accountability for the holdup. He pointed out that while the foundation stone was laid last year and the bhumi pujan was held last month, no work has begun. In a veiled swipe at CM Saini, he warned the project might take another 18 months to get off the ground.
